How much would $1,000 invested in BlackRock Energy & Resources Trust be worth today?
If you invested $1,000 in BlackRock Energy & Resources Trust (BGR) 5 years ago on 2021-07-09, your investment would be worth $1,586 today, representing a +58.6% total return, growing at a compounded rate of 9.7% per year (CAGR).

What is BlackRock Energy & Resources Trust's average annual return?
The comp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of BGR over the past 5 years is 9.7%, growing at a compounded rate each year. Individual years vary significantly — BGR's best recent year was 2022 (+28.8%) and worst was 2024 (+0.1%).
